I noticed your car is the same color as mine. The interior color of my car is called 'barley', which I was told translates to the new 'champagne'. However, when I got the champagne set the headrest color was slightly clearer than the rest of my leather. The difference is subtle but obvious.

The quality of the components are really good and my local dealer would do a complete install for $350. So $127 + $350 is a great price.

In the end, I didn't do the install only because the resolution of the screen is only 240p for a 7 inch screen. Compare that with an ipad that is 720p and you can slip an ipad into the rear pocket if you like. A 16 GB ipad version 1 can be had for $299, or for around $600 you can actually get a pretty compelling alternative to the fixed rear entertainment system. Remember you still have to hook up an ipod or a DVD player with this system...

Great looking set, but in my opinion time and technology has just passed it by...
